Memorial service to be held in memory of Omagh bombing victims

It's hoped the anniversary of the Omagh bombing will reinforce a message of peace for the north.

17 years ago today 29 people lost their lives in the blast – the single biggest atrocity of the troubles. 

A memorial service will be held tomorrow in memory of those who died and the 220 others who were injured.

Speaking with Citybeat Michael Gallagher whose son Aidan died in the attack says today's a chance for Omagh to show its strength
